Moodle minimum

Every Saint Martin's course will have a Moodle course created and students enrolled.  When created, the courses will be hidden from students, so that faculty will have an opportunity to add content prior to students logging in.  As the "Moodle minimum," all courses should eventually have the following:

  • Syllabus. Administrative assistants will be trained to load a syllabus, should some faculty members prefer not to use Moodle themselves.

  • Course evaluation form. This will be included automatically in each Moodle course, albeit "hidden".  Faculty (or their division's administrative assistant) will need to adjust the dates the evaluation will be available for students.  All online courses will use the online course evaluation form.  Other faculty will have the option of piloting the form or continuing to use the paper form. Faculty will not have access to the results until after grades are due.  Currently use of the online evaluation form is at the discretion of each division's dean.

The Moodle minimum will give students a single place to look for their course syllabus and any online course materials. Those faculty wishing to use their faculty homepage or a publisher's site for course materials can easily include a link directing their students to this resource in the Moodle course.
